Fee Simple
  • Ambiguity: Appraisal Institute definition v. legal definition
  • What is an encumbrance?
  • What is a lease?

 

Alternative to fee simple: Leased Fee
  • Legal definition (Duration, alternative to fee simple: leasehold)
  • TARE 15th ed. on the two definitions
  • Different purposes of the two definitions (Appraisal Institute: identify
how above / below market rent might impact value; Legal: identify the value of a permanent interest)
Leasehold
  • What is a lease? (revisited)
  • Real property or personal property?
Applications
  • Fee simple in condemnation in the unit rule
  • Fee simple absolute v. defeasible fee
  • Intangibles

About the Speaker
Josh WoodJoshua Wood is Senior Managing Director of Litigation for Valbridge Property Advisors | Houston. Mr. Wood is a state certified general appraiser in Arizona, Texas, Louisiana and Oklahoma. He holds the MAI and AI-GRS designations from the Appraisal Institute and is a member of the State Bar of Arizona. He is also an arbitrator on the Construction Panel of the American Arbitration Association.

As an instructor for the Appraisal Institute, Mr. Wood teaches litigation and regulatory compliance and serves as a course reviewer. He is also an instructor for the International Right of Way Association and is an AQB Certified USPAP Instructor for the Appraisal Foundation. He has presented lectures for bar associations and national conferences and has been published in law reviews and journals.

Mr. Wood’s professional work is focused on appraisals and consultation for litigation. His opinions have been used in conjunction with a variety of legal disputes, including property tax, condemnation, bankruptcy, construction defect, breach of contract, title defect, environmental contamination, partition and estate tax.
